- don't overwrite logs
authorBart Polot <bart@net.in.tum.de>
Tue, 9 Jul 2013 23:03:31 +0000 (23:03 +0000)
committerBart Polot <bart@net.in.tum.de>
Tue, 9 Jul 2013 23:03:31 +0000 (23:03 +0000)
src/mesh/beautify_log.sh

index 086a024068566326887915e214db978ecb2a7850..55ea5883a409761d399852fecc65af1af359df0a 100755 (executable)
@@ -4,14 +4,13 @@ cat __tmp_peers | while read line; do
     PEER=`echo $line | sed -e 's/.*\[\(....\)\].*/\1/'`
     PID=`echo $line | sed -e 's/.*mesh-\([0-9]*\).*/\1/'`
     echo "$PID => $PEER"
-    cat log | sed -e "s/mesh-$PID/MESH $PEER/" > __tmp_log
-    mv __tmp_log log
+    cat log | sed -e "s/mesh-$PID/MESH $PEER/" > .log
 done 
 
 rm __tmp_peers
 
-cat log | sed -e 's/mesh-api-/mesh-api-                                            /g' > __tmp_log
-mv __tmp_log log
+cat .log | sed -e 's/mesh-api-/mesh-api-                                            /g' > .log2
+mv .log2 .log
 
-kwrite log --geometry 960x1140-960 &
+kwrite .log --geometry 960x1140-960 &